Experience:
I taught non-native Arabic speakers classical and modern Arabic, literature and journalism at different levels, including beginners, intermediate and advanced levels, as well as colloquial. I taught students from different nationalities: Americans, Europeans, Turkish �etc. And students from international universities like: SOAS University of London, University of Oslo, Brigham Young University, and University of Oxford. |

Approach |
Approach:
My tutoring approach includes gaining recognition. It helps to attain recognition of my qualifications by being actively involved in the knowledge or discipline I am representing, by degree or other official documentation, or by both. Understand the curriculum. I make sure I know and understand the curriculum or syllabus I am going to teach, so that I can maximize the effectiveness of my lesson plans. Prepare my lessons and practice them. Be very well organized from the first. It is better to be over-prepared than to run dry out of ideas way through a session. Listen to my students; respond to what they know or don't understand, and prepare future lessons to account for any deficiencies. |
